TL;DR
Staff Engineer, Safety-Critical Software (Aerospace) (C++/Real-Time Assurance): Building and integrating safety-critical software and a configurable Run-Time Assurance module for autonomous aerospace systems with an accent on robust fail-safe behavior, airworthiness standards, and certifiability. Focus on architecting high-performance software, integrating it with mission autonomy and flight-control systems, and guiding engineering practices through certification-oriented development.

Location: San Diego, California, United States; on-site

Company

hirify.global develops autonomy software and platforms for resilient intelligence in complex environments.

What you will do

  • Drive the architecture, development, integration, and testing of an extensible Run-Time Assurance module for autonomous systems.
  • Integrate safety capabilities with low-assurance mission autonomy software and high-assurance middleware.
  • Deploy and test the Run-Time Assurance capability across physical platforms and operating conditions.
  • Establish software development practices covering code analysis, audit trails, reviews, and testing.
  • Create certification artifacts such as analysis reports, software documentation, architecture decision records, interface control diagrams, and system models.
  • Mentor engineers on safe software development and software quality practices.

Requirements

  • Typically 10+ years of related experience with a bachelor's degree, 9+ years with a master's degree, 7+ years with a PhD, or equivalent experience.
  • Demonstrated expertise designing and developing C++ safety-critical software with real-time guarantees.
  • Deep knowledge of C++ software architecture patterns and practical implementation.
  • Experience integrating software with real-world physical systems and improving performance and reliability.
  • Strong knowledge of DO-178C and MIL-HDBK-516 software assurance standards.
  • Strong Git and Linux skills, modern development practices, technical leadership, and mentoring experience.

Nice to have

  • Experience with strict C++ coding standards such as MISRA C++ and JSF AV C++.
  • Hands-on experience taking software through an airworthiness certification process.
